MINUTE OF PROCEEDINGS

TUESDAY 11 MARCH 2008

The Assembly met at 10.30 am, the Speaker in the Chair

1. Personal Prayer or Meditation

Members observed two minutes’ silence.

2. Executive Committee Business
2.1 Statement - Discovery of Official Documents at Camlough

The Minister of Education, Ms Caitríona Ruane, made a statement to the Assembly on the discovery of official documents at Camlough, following which she replied to questions.

3. Committee Business
3.1 Motion - Report on the Devolution of Policing and Justice Matters

Proposed:
That this Assembly approves the report of the Assembly and Executive Review Committee relating to the devolution of policing and justice matters, and agrees that, as required by section 18 of the Northern Ireland (St. Andrews Agreement) Act 2006, it should be submitted to the Secretary of State for Northern Ireland, before 27 March 2008, as a report of the Northern Ireland Assembly.

[Chairperson, Assembly and Executive Review Committee]

Debate ensued.

The Deputy Speaker (Mr Molloy) in the chair.

The sitting was suspended at 12.38 pm.

The sitting resumed at 2.00 pm with the Deputy Speaker (Mr McClarty) in the chair.

3.2 Motion - Report on the Devolution of Policing and Justice Matters (cont’d)

Debate resumed on the Motion.

The Question being put, the Motion was carried without division.

4.Adjournment

Proposed:
That the Assembly do now adjourn.

[The Speaker]

The Assembly adjourned at 3.25 pm.
